When and where is the O-Day Festival? The O-Day Festival takes place on Friday 20 February at UWA's Crawley campus (35 Stirling Hwy, Crawley). What time does it all start? New students will attend the Commencement Ceremony at Somerville Auditorium at 10am, with all the stalls and action on James Oval starting up as soon as Commencement finishes (at 11am). The Oak Lawn concert opens at 2pm and runs til 6.30pm. Where can I find out about other O-Week activities? Check out the O-Week website for details on Kick Off Day, Fac Find Days and heaps more. How do I join a club or society? Just find their stall at the O-Day Festival and ask to sign up! Most clubs charge a membership fee of $5-10, and Gold Guild members get $2 off every affiliated club membership so don't forget to show your Gold Guild sticker when you sign up! How do I join the Guild? If you didn't sign up for the Guild during Enrolment, just head to the Guild Student Centre in Guild Village on O-Day to sign up and activate your Guild membership. There is no cost to join the Guild but if you would like to access a huge range of services and benefits you can elect to pay the Amenities and Services Fee and become a Gold Guild member. To find out more about the benefits of becoming a Guild member and the Amenities and Services Fee, click here. Do I have to be a UWA student to come along? Nope - the O-Day Festival (including the concert on Oak Lawn) is open to everyone, students and non-students alike. So feel free to bring your mates along! Entry to the concert is free for UWA students who are Gold Guild members and $20 for others. Will there be food at the O-Day Festival? Absolutely! If you're not full from all the free samples from stalls on James Oval, a range of food options (including vegetarian and halal) will be available at the Guild Cafe and Guild Refectory in Guild Village, as well as Hackett Cafe on the North end of campus.
